Environmental agents and erectile dysfunction: a study in a consulting population.

Alejandro Oliva1, Alain Giami, Luc Multigner

  • 1Unidad de Andrologia, Hospital Italiano Garibaldi, Rosario, Argentina.

Journal of Andrology
|June 18, 2002
PubMed
Summary

Exposure to pesticides and solvents significantly increases the risk of severe erectile dysfunction. Environmental agents interfere with erectile ability, impacting men

Area of Science:

  • Environmental Medicine
  • Andrology
  • Occupational Health

Background:

  • Erectile dysfunction (ED) affects a significant number of men.
  • Environmental factors are increasingly recognized as potential contributors to ED.

Purpose of the Study:

  • To investigate the association between exposure to chemical and physical environmental agents and erectile dysfunction.
  • To identify specific environmental risk factors for different patterns of ED.

Main Methods:

  • A case-control study involving 199 men seeking treatment for ED.
  • Nocturnal penile tumescence and rigidity monitoring to classify erectile patterns.
  • Detailed interviews to assess exposure to pesticides, solvents, and heat, with statistical analysis using logistic regression.

Main Results:

  • Pesticide exposure was associated with a 7.1-fold increased risk of a flat erectile pattern.
  • Solvent exposure showed a 12.2-fold increased risk of a flat erectile pattern.
  • Heat exposure had a weaker association with flat erectile patterns; associations with irregular patterns were less significant.

Conclusions:

  • Environmental agents, particularly pesticides and solvents, are significant risk factors for severe erectile dysfunction.
  • These agents appear to interfere with the physiological mechanisms of penile erection.
  • Further research into occupational and environmental health is warranted to mitigate ED risks.
